How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Long Island?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Long Island Studio Apartments | $2,987 | $1,450 | $8,000 |
| Long Island 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,142 | $1,000 | $10,000+ |
| Long Island 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,847 | $1,500 | $10,000+ |
| Long Island 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,773 | $2,421 | $10,000+ |
| Long Island 4 Bedroom Apartments | $6,630 | $1,708 | $10,000+ |
| Long Island 5 Bedroom Apartments | $5,173 | $4,300 | $6,720 |
| Long Island 6 Bedroom Apartments | $5,412 | $3,850 | $7,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Long Island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Long Island with Studio?
Currently the most affordable Studio in Long Island is at Bay Plaza listed at $1,375.
How much is the average rent for a Studio Long Island Apartment?
The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Long Island is $2,987.
What is the largest available Studio Long Island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Long Island is a 2,000 square feet unit starting from $12,500 at 349-351 Kent Ave.
What is the average size for Long Island Studio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Studio rental in Long Island is currently 459 sq ft.
